The Toronto Zoo tries to keep the animals on their schedule during the COVID-19 shutdown.
TORONTO, ON- MARCH 18 - Fintan catches a meatball. Zookeeper Kim Welfle tosses the zoos lions Fintan and Makali meatballs during the usual meet the keeper time as the Toronto Zoo tries to keep the animals on their schedule during the COVID-19 shutdown. in Toronto. March 18, 2020. (Steve Russell/Toronto Star via Getty Images)
